Norfolk International Airport shares most popular routes in 2023 Here are our top routes for 2023 according to this article Orlando International Airport (MCO) – about 308 passengers each day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ta Airport – about 228 passengers each day Tampa International Airport – about 178 passengers each day DFW Airport – about 168 passengers each day San Diego International Airport – about 167 passengers each day It also mentions that the Airport Authority is anticipating that we may run out of parking during the summer months as the airport will have a record number of seats available. link
